There's a YouTube vid showing very impressive water resistance of the G3. For some reason LG doesn't tout it.

If the G3 survived being submerged in water it was an experience based on pure luck. LG will never tout water resistant because it has none. The back cover offers 0 protection to the battery, Sim card and SD slot. The circuitry below is open to the back with actual holes. Water has full reign to enter the phone at numerous locations, not to mention the vulnerable Micro USB port. The Galaxy s5 achieves water resistance only by sealing the screen, and circuitry with adhesive, the back cover protects the battery and card slots with a gasket and the charging port has a water tight cover.
